Speakers dont work

My speakers are not working they dont even make a fuzzy noise when i turn them on and the green power light is even on and i already checked all the speaker settings and i made sure they were plugged in and all that can some one Plz tell me what to do to fix this problem
 
well ermm... check your volume control? start, all programs, acceseries, entertainment, volume control or whatever. make sure it's not on mute and the volume isn't all the way down. if that doesn't work try another speaker system, headphones or something, if that doesn't work make sure your sound card is plugged in and enabled on bios... and finally if that doesn't work, toss it out and get a new one :)
 
Check the speaker wire. Make sure there are no bad wires. Make sure you have the latest soundcard drivers. Make sure your card is configured properly, check to see if it's working properly in the device manager. Play test music. Make sure you speakers are plugged into the wall, each other, etc. If all connections are made, everything is up to date, everything is configured properly, and you still get no noise, music, etc, then bring your speakers back.
